FC CLACTON have postponed their next two first-team matches after receiving a positive Covid-19 test.

The Seasiders' next two Thurlow Nunn League premier division matches against Woodbridge Town, which was due to take place on Saturday and Hadleigh United (next Tuesday) have been postponed.

In addition, the clubhouse at the Austin Arena will remain closed for the next two weeks as a result of the positive test.

In a club statement, the club said: 'A number of our First Team & one of our Committee developed Covid symptoms late last week, following which they undertook tests & self isolated.

'Results from the first of these tests have now been received, testing positive for Covid 19.

'As a result we have asked the Thurlow Nunn League to postpone our next 2 matches, which they have agreed to & we now await results from the remaining tests.

'As a precaution we are also undertaking a thorough deep clean of the Clubhouse & that will be closed for the next 2 weeks.

'We stress this was First Team players & no connection to our other senior or any youth teams.

'Like other clubs we have a thorough & robust Covid Risk Assessment in place, which has been adhered to at all times.

'Having positive tests is a stark reminder of how aggressive this virus is & how we all need to do more to stop its spread.

'Our First Team home game this Saturday is postponed but as it stands all other fixtures are unaffected & will go ahead.

'This situation could obviously change quickly & if it does we will do our best to keep everyone updated.

'The virus is still out there. We must all be even more vigilant, even more careful & follow all advice to try & stop it spreading. Thank you.'
